Why Traditional CMMS and SCADA Alone Fall Short
Even the best SCADA offers incredible visibility into pressures, temperatures and flows. And a legacy CMMS can track work orders. But when they sit in silos, you face:
• Repetitive problem solving, over and over.
• Knowledge locked in notebooks or tribal memory.
• Delays as engineers hunt for past work orders.
• Manual data entry inviting errors and oversights.
That’s why seamless CMMS integration matters. It knits SCADA’s real-time data to a shared, structured maintenance brain. Now you spot anomalies early, zero-in on root causes and turn alerts into automated work orders. No more firefighting. No more guesswork.
How AI Turns SCADA Signals into Action
With iMaintain’s AI-powered CMMS, those live SCADA tags and IoT feeds get a brainy upgrade. Here’s how it works in practice:
- Data Capture
Real-time readings flow from Ignition or your existing SCADA into the AI layer. - Contextualisation
The platform matches signals to specific assets, past fixes and known failure modes. - Anomaly Detection
Subtle shifts—vibration spikes, temperature drifts—raise a flag before breakdown. - Automated Work Orders
The system creates priority work orders in your CMMS, complete with recommended fix steps and parts. - Continuous Learning
Engineers add notes post-repair; the AI refines its model, so insights compound over time.

Building a Proactive Maintenance Strategy with Live Data
Shifting to proactive upkeep takes more than flair. It needs a clear roadmap:
• Audit your assets and SCADA feeds.
• Map signal tags to failure patterns.
• Clean and standardise historical work orders.
• Pilot anomaly detection on a critical line.
• Scale out across the plant in phases.
• Train engineers on AI-powered troubleshooting.

Best Practices for Seamless CMMS Integration in Manufacturing
When you’re ready to roll out integration plant-wide, keep these tips in mind:
- Involve Operations and Maintenance Teams
Get buy-in early; their insights guide practical configurations. - Prioritise Critical Assets
Focus on high-value machines first to prove ROI quickly. - Standardise Data
Clean up legacy tags, unify naming conventions and merge duplicate entries. - Use Middleware Judiciously
Where out-of-the-box connectors fall short, add lightweight bridges rather than heavy rewrites. - Leverage Visual Dashboards
Create simple Ignition screens or iMaintain widgets so anyone sees health metrics at a glance. - Measure and Iterate
Track KPIs: downtime hours, repeat failures avoided, maintenance cost per unit.
